>>> here comes another update to frame.safe_for_sender. 
>>> If the PC at a place where the stack doesn't match the _frame_size we sometimes read an invalid return PC. 
>>> In this case we read one that pointed into the Safepoint blob. 
>>> 
>>> We now pretty much guarded for all kind of blobs in safe_for_sender,
>>> so I've changed the method to not assert in the end but to do it the same was as the frame_sparc.cpp did it. Everything that is not
>>> a nmethod at the end of the method is not safe. 
>>> 
>>> I've also changed another check for a frame_size == 0 to frame_size <= 0 to make it somewhat more safer.
